Stationary oxygen concentrator. A stationary oxygen concentrator weighs about 22 lbs (10 kilograms). It's got handles to carry the system or wheels on the bottom to roll it. It runs on electrical energy, so you plug it into an electrical outlet in your house.

, you will discover near to 800,000 clients at present using very long-phrase oxygen therapy in the U.S. Property oxygen therapy is generally prescribed for anyone with hypoxemia (very low blood oxygen levels), typically thought to be a blood oxygen saturation of 88% or significantly less although awake and at relaxation.
